Looks to open 20 Circle K c-stores over the next five years.

McDougall Energy Inc. is set to be the first company to take advantage of Alimentation Couche-Tard Inc.’s recently announced new full-service franchise offerings with the Circle K brand in Ontario, Canada. McDougall Energy Inc. signed an agreement with Couche-Tard on 20 sites to open within the next five years.

Circle K entered the Ontario franchise market to foster the growth of the brand and complement Couche-Tard’s nearly 10,000 stores in North America, including over 2,200 in Canada, and 15,000 globally.

McDougall Energy is a privately-owned Canadian business, which has been serving energy customers for over 70 years including through its expanding network of retail fuel dealers in Ontario and British Columbia, Canada.

“We believe McDougall Energy will be an excellent partner in our growth in the Ontario market,” added Matt McCure, vice president, Circle K Worldwide Franchise. “McDougall Energy has proven itself as a successful owner of dealer networks, and will help drive traffic to the Circle K brand and its popular products for customers on the go in the Ontario province.”

“As a company looking for continued growth, it is a natural fit for us to partner with Circle K,” stated Darren McDougall, president of McDougall Energy. “We are pleased to be aligning with the success and experience that comes with Circle K and to expand our dealer network with a leading brand in Canadian convenience stores.”
